Product Description:
The AM8023-0E21-0000 is a synchronous servo motor manufactured by Beckhoff and offered in the AM Synchronous Servo Motors series. As a rotary actuator in industrial automation, it converts controlled electrical energy from a drive into precise rotational motion for positioning axes, feeder stages, or pick-and-place heads. This standard version is suitable for general-purpose motion tasks that require compact size, integrated feedback, and coordinated drive control. It is intended for applications where repeatable movement and stable servo response are important during continuous machine operation.
One electrical feature is its brake circuit, which accepts a supply of 24 VDC; this voltage energizes the release coil so the built-in brake can disengage without an external converter. An encoder identified as OCT multi-turn provides absolute position recall after power loss. Mechanical integration is simplified by the 58 mm flange, a standardized square interface that supports accurate alignment during installation. When the shaft is locked, the brake supplies 2 Nm of holding torque, helping prevent drift on vertical or overhung loads during shutdown. Thermal behavior and torque-speed curves are linked to the stator’s electrical characteristics, which are grouped under Winding Code E so the motor can be matched to the available DC-bus voltage and the required acceleration profile.
For wiring, the motor uses a rotatable angular connector or terminal box, allowing the cable outlet to be positioned for tight cabinet layouts and reduced bending stress. Overall housing size is referenced by length code 3, which indicates the third length increment within the AM8023 frame and sets the stack height for the magnetic package. A smooth shaft simplifies coupler installation where keys or serrations are unnecessary and also helps reduce particle retention in clean production areas. This configuration is ready for integration with AX5000 or third-party EtherCAT drives.
